Hangover in Heaven Parfum — a fragrance by Philly & Phill

Philly & Phill Hangover in Heaven is a 2026 extrait de parfum created for those who love expressive compositions with character.

This unisex fragrance belongs to the fougère and fruity families, opening with a fresh citrus accord that gradually becomes spicy, green, and amber-balsamic.

The release continues the philosophy of Philly & Phill, a Munich-based perfume house founded in 2009 by a married couple.

The name Hangover in Heaven sets the mood for the composition: this is neither literal sweetness nor a carefree aquatic fragrance, but a contrasting impression after a vibrant night, when the freshness of morning meets warm, almost hypnotic skin-like nuances.

The extrait de parfum concentration makes the scent particularly rich, while its stated very strong sillage emphasizes its presence in the surrounding space.

Character and development on the skin

Bergamot, mandarin, and melon top notes open Hangover in Heaven with a juicy, cool accord.

Here, the citrus sparkle is softened by the rounded fruitiness of melon, so the opening feels expansive and modern rather than sharp.

A green lavender nuance gradually adds cleanliness and fougère structure to the composition.

In the heart, the fragrance becomes more expressive: orange blossom lends it a soft white-floral smoothness, while pink pepper adds an energetic spicy vibration.

This combination does not push the perfume in an exclusively feminine or masculine direction, preserving its universal balance. On the skin, the freshness gives way to a warm, slightly dry, sensual impression.

Longevity, sillage, and wearability

The base of Hangover in Heaven is built around ambrox, incense, clove, and pear.

The ambrox accord supports a powerful, clean, and noticeable trail, incense adds depth, and clove makes the finish spicy and distinctive.

Pear softens the resinous-spicy base with a fruity nuance, allowing the composition to remain appealing even as it develops intensely.

Because of its very strong sillage, the perfume is best allowed to develop gradually, with the occasion taken into account.

A minimal application is sufficient for the office or a small room, while its richness is especially striking in the evening, outdoors, or in cool weather.

No precise recommendations for the number of sprays on skin or clothing have been stated for this release, so the dosage should be adjusted individually, starting with a small amount.

Description of the composition

The pyramid of Hangover in Heaven Parfum opens with bergamot, mandarin and melon: the citrus-fruity accord feels fresh, juicy and slightly cool.

Lavender, orange blossom and pink pepper unfold at the heart, combining green freshness, soft white florals and spicy brightness.

The base is built around ambrox, clove, incense and pear. Ambrox creates a dense ambery backdrop, incense adds resinous depth, while clove intensifies the spicy character of the finish.

Pear softens the base with a fruity nuance and connects it to the juicy opening of the fragrance.
